A bill to reauthorize the PROTECT Our Children Act of 2008, and for other purposes.
PROTECT Our Children Reauthorization Act of 2024
This bill reauthorizes through FY2027 the federal framework to combat the online exploitation of children.
Specifically, the bill reauthorizes through FY2027 (1) the National Strategy for Child Exploitation Prevention and Interdiction, and (2) the National Internet Crimes Against Children Task Force Program.
